Summary of the comparison

Stanley Park Junior School and Wood Field Primary School are primary schools in Carshalton.

  • Stanley Park Junior School scores 69 out of 100 (grade C, average) and Wood Field Primary School scores 75 out of 100 (grade B, strong). Wood Field Primary School is ahead on our composite score.

  • Stanley Park Junior School was judged Good and Wood Field Primary School was judged exceptional.

  • On the share of pupils meeting the expected standard in reading, writing and maths at Key Stage 2, the latest published figures are 70.0% for Stanley Park Junior School and 62.0% for Wood Field Primary School.

  • The share of pupils meeting the expected standard at Key Stage 2 has fallen at Stanley Park Junior School (79.0% in 2022-23, 70.0% in 2024-25) and has fallen at Wood Field Primary School (67.0% in 2022-23, 62.0% in 2024-25).
